Preferred Label : nucleoside q;

MeSH definition : A modified nucleoside which is present in the first position of the anticodon of tRNA-tyrosine, tRNA-histidine, tRNA-asparagine and tRNA-aspartic acid of many organisms. It is believed to play a role in the regulatory function of tRNA. Nucleoside Q can be further modified to nucleoside Q*, which has a mannose or galactose moiety linked to position 4 of its cyclopentenediol moiety.;

MeSH synonym : q ribonucleoside; q-ribonucleoside; q nucleoside; queuosine;

MeSH hyponym : nucleoside Q*;
